Responsibilities The Academic Mapping Coordinator is responsible for coordinating the Mapping process for the College of Arts & Sciences encompassing over 80 undergraduate majors.

Reviewing all CoAS transfer applications and making admission decisions consistent with CoAS policies and procedures and coordinating with the FSU Office of Admissions, verifying applicants are meeting the admission criteria for the intended major, entering the admission decision, and setting Map Term based on university policy and criteria set by the academic department where the major is housed (if accepted).

Performing detailed evaluation of transfer credits for verification of prerequisite coursework and equivalencies, and as needed, consulting designated departmental faculty and performing external research to locate and establish prerequisites and equivalencies in FSU's system.

Reviewing and processing primary and secondary major changes and dual degree changes, analyzing transcripts and guiding students on petitioning when adding second major or dual degree post 90-hours.

Serving as quality control, assisting departments with major change information through training and communication and ensuring departments and students are aware of status and re-submission process when denials occur.

Performing detailed audits each semester of newly admitted students to ensure all students are placed correctly and rectifies any errors found. Assisting in communications with departments regarding the Predictive Hold list each semester.

Serving as point of contact to interpret policies and assist students and departments in matters pertaining to the Academic Mapping process.
